Ambassador of Montenegro makes a farewell call

First Deputy Prime Minister and Minister of Foreign Affairs of the Republic of Serbia Ivica Dacic today received a farewell call from Branislav Micunovic, Ambassador of Montenegro to the Republic of Serbia.

During the conversation, which took place in a friendly and constructive atmosphere, the current state of bilateral relations between the Republics of Serbia and Montenegro had been considered and the hope expressed that they would be further improved in the forthcoming period.

Minister Dacic thanked Ambassador Micunovic for a good long-term cooperation, and wished him happiness and success in his further work.

At the end of the meeting, First Deputy Prime Minister and Minister of Foreign Affairs of the Republic of Serbia Ivica Dacic and Ambassador of Montenegro to the Republic of Serbia Branislav Micunovic signed an Agreement between the Government of the Republic of Serbia and the Government of Montenegro on the gainful activity of certain dependents of members of their diplomatic and consular missions.
